在这个数字化时代,数据分析已经成为了企业决策和个人学习的重要工具。而支付宝小程序作为一个广泛使用的平台,结合Echarts图表库,可以轻松实现数据的可视化展示。本文将为你详细解析如何使用支付宝小程序和Echarts图表,实现数据的可视化效果。
一、支付宝小程序简介
支付宝小程序是一种无需下载即可使用的应用,它依托于支付宝这个庞大的用户群体,具有极高的用户粘性和便捷性。支付宝小程序的开发和发布流程相对简单,适合快速搭建轻量级应用。
二、Echarts图表库介绍
Echarts是一个使用JavaScript编写的开源可视化库,它提供丰富的图表类型,如折线图、柱状图、饼图、散点图等,能够满足不同场景下的数据分析需求。Echarts图表库易于使用,并且具有高性能和良好的兼容性。
三、支付宝小程序与Echarts图表结合
1. 环境准备
首先,确保你的电脑已安装Node.js和npm。然后,创建一个新的支付宝小程序项目,并安装Echarts图表库。
# 创建支付宝小程序项目
alipay mini init my-app
# 进入项目目录
cd my-app
# 安装Echarts图表库
npm install echarts --save
2. 引入Echarts图表库
在项目的src目录下创建一个名为echarts.js的文件,将Echarts图表库的代码复制进去。
// echarts.js
// 引入Echarts主模块
const echarts = require('echarts/lib/echarts');
// 引入柱状图
require('echarts/lib/chart/bar');
// 引入提示框和标题组件
require('echarts/lib/component/tooltip');
require('echarts/lib/component/title');
3. 使用Echarts图表
在支付宝小程序的页面中,使用Echarts图表展示数据。以下是一个简单的示例:
<!-- index.wxml -->
<view class="container">
<canvas canvas-id="myChart" width="300" height="200"></canvas>
</view>
// index.js
Page({
data: {
chartInstance: null
},
onLoad: function() {
this.chartInstance = echarts.init(this.selectComponent('#myChart'));
this.setChartOption();
},
setChartOption: function() {
const option = {
title: {
text: 'Echarts图表示例'
},
tooltip: {},
xAxis: {
data: ['A', 'B', 'C', 'D']
},
yAxis: {},
series: [{
name: '销量',
type: 'bar',
data: [5, 20, 36, 10]
}]
};
this.chartInstance.setOption(option);
}
});
4. 部署小程序
完成以上步骤后,你可以通过支付宝开发者工具将小程序部署到线上,体验数据的可视化效果。
四、总结
通过本文的介绍,相信你已经掌握了如何使用支付宝小程序和Echarts图表进行数据可视化。在实际应用中,你可以根据需求调整图表类型、样式和数据,以实现更好的展示效果。希望这篇文章能够帮助你轻松上手支付宝小程序和Echarts图表,开启你的数据分析之旅!
